Aji Assamese Daily (Assamese: আজি) is an Assamese language newspaper published in Guwahati, Assam, India. (Aji = today).

On 24 March 2009 the executive editor of the paper, Anil Majumder, was shot dead. Majummder had been instrumental in reviving the paper, which had become almost defunct, in recent years.

Possibly he had been targeted because he had been "advocating talks between the ULFA and the government".[1]
